Ivan asked me to post what we can expect next week. Everyone should be aware that they will have 1/10 the amount of the shares
and probably the shares will be worth 10 times what the closing price is tomorrow. If we close at 1 3/4 for example, the opening price should be 17 1/2 on Mon.
I say should be the opening price because there is no guarantee that that will be the case. The opening price Mon. morning is dependent
in the Market Makers. After opening, the market will decide the price
of the stock. I believe that the MMs have plenty of inventory stored up and have no interest in driving the price of the stock down on Mon. Quite the contrary. They've got cheap shares to sell at a higher price.
